## Sensor drift: what to do at 3am

If the GrowLoop controller starts reporting humidity swings that don't match the backup probes in the Fernwick greenhouse, it's almost always sensor drift, not an actual climate event. Don't panic and don't touch the vents manually. First, restart the calibration daemon and give it ten minutes to re-baseline. If readings still disagree by more than 5%, flip the controller into safe mode. The safe-mode thresholds it will use are these.

config for yahap-bajof:
[istix]
host = istix.qorvelsys.internal
user = istix_svc
database = istix_prod

## Support

Reviewers: ChalkLine solves timetables via constraint propagation; see `solver/core` for the model. Don't approve changes to heuristic weights without a benchmark run against the Northbridge fixture set. Performance regressions over 5% block merge. Open questions go in the review thread first; architectural disputes escalate to the solver maintainers. For anything urgent — broken fixtures, nondeterministic output, CI timeouts — contact the ChalkLine maintainers directly at the address below.

alerts address for kajog-tadup: druox@plorvanet.internal

## Partitioning 101 for Releases

Quick heads-up before your first deploy at Bramblewick: the events table in Orchardline is partitioned by month, and a new partition gets created automatically on the 25th for the upcoming month. If that job fails, inserts start bouncing on the 1st — so check it as part of your release checklist. The helper script `make-partition` will backfill anything missing, but it needs direct database access. When you run it, point it at the primary using the connection string below.

warehouse DSN: mssql://rusdor_svc:0FSWCn9@db-951a.paliqforge.local:5432/ulawyn